Меняем пароль WordPress через панель администратора
- Если вы знаете email, который задали при создании сайта, перейдите на сайт по адресу ваш сайт/wp-admin:
То есть возможность восстановить доступ к сайту с помощью письма, которое придет на email, с инструкцией по восстановлению пароля сайта,
Восстанавливаем пароль WordPress через phpMyAdmin
С помощью административной панели хостинга и базы данных PhpMyAdmin, можно изменить пароль администратора, если остальные способы по той или иной причине не подходят. Для изменения пароля достаточно внести правки в таблицу wp_users :
Изменение значений только одного поля, user_pass, позволят вам получить доступ к сайту:
Пароль необходимо обязательно сохранять со значением Функции равной “md5”.
Восстанавливаем пароль через functions.php
Если вы забыли пароль к phpMyAdmin, то этот способ подойдет вам, в этом способе вам нужно внести правки в файл functions.php. А именно, в файле functions.php, который расположен в папке с вашей темой wordpress.
Добавьте в конце файла functions.php, следующий код:
Поэтому будем использовать способ представленный ниже:
if( isset( $_GET[‘init_new_pass_set’] ) && $login = $_GET[‘init_new_pass_set’] ){
add_action( ‘init’, function() use ( $login ){
wp_set_password( ‘newpassword‘, get_user_by( ‘login’, $login )->ID );
wp_die( “Пароль пользователя $login изменен” );
} );
}
При изменении пароля этим способом вы обязательно должны помнить логин администратора. Вместо ‘newpassword ‘ можно использовать любой другой пароль:
www.адрес сайта.ru?init_new_pass_set=логин пользователя